Eneugh

/ɪˈnuː/ archaic adverb

Definition

An archaic or Scottish spelling of 'enough,' meaning sufficient quantity or degree.

Etymology

Middle English and Old English variant spelling of 'enough,' reflecting the phonetic spelling conventions and pronunciation patterns of Middle Scots and Northern English dialects.

Kelly Says

Medieval scribes spelled words phonetically based on their accent—'eneugh' shows how a Scottish speaker pronounced 'enough,' and these old spellings give us clues about regional accents from 500 years ago!
